Payroll Supervisor Job Description

At Jobot, we are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Payroll Supervisor to join our team. As a Payroll Supervisor, you will be responsible for overseeing and managing our payroll department, ensuring accurate and timely processing of payroll transactions, and providing excellent customer service to our employees.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Supervise and coordinate activities of payroll staff to ensure accurate and timely processing of payroll transactions.
  • Ensure accurate and timely processing of payroll updates, including new hires, terminations, and changes to pay rates.
  • Prepare and maintain accurate records and reports of payroll transactions.
  • Ensure compliance with federal, state, and local payroll, wage, and hour laws and best practices.
  • Facilitate audits by providing records and documentation to auditors.
  • Identify and recommend updates to payroll processing software, systems, and procedures.
  • Perform payroll general ledger setup and processing.
  • Handle multi-state payroll processing and related tasks.
  • Develop and implement policies and procedures for the payroll process.
  • Collaborate with the Human Resources (HR) and Accounting departments to align and reconcile payroll data.
Requirements:
  •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, Business Administration, or related field.
  • A minimum of 5 years of experience supervising a payroll team.
  • Experience with multi-state payroll, wage laws, and payroll taxes.
  • Proficiency in payroll software along with strong skills in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, Outlook).
  • Strong understanding of the payroll process, including payroll taxes, employee benefits, and other deductions.
  • Excellent understanding of multi-location payroll and taxes.
  • Extensive knowledge of payroll functions including preparation, balancing, internal controls, and payroll taxes.
  • Strong knowledge of generally accepted accounting principles.
  • Ability to manage and lead staff to excellent performance.
  • Certified Payroll Professional (CPP) designation preferred.
